Technical Inspiration
Tips to perfectly capture silence from a technical perspective:
- Use a low ISO setting to minimize image noise.
- Experiment with long exposures to gently capture movement.
- Work with a wide aperture to focus on your main subject and blur the background.
- Use a tripod to avoid camera shake and ensure sharpness in your image.
- Employ manual focus to precisely target the desired part of the scene.
Post-Processing Inspiration
Shape the silence in your images during editing:
- Enhance the mood with gentle color corrections to amplify the calmness.
- Use vignetting to draw attention to the center of your shot.
- Experiment with clarity and softening to create a dreamy atmosphere.
- Apply dodge and burn techniques to selectively control light and shadow.
- Use selective saturation to highlight specific elements in your image.
